If cos Θ = negative 4 over 7, what are the values of sin Θ and tan Θ? sin Θ = ±square root 33 over 7; tan Θ = ±square root 33 over 4 sin Θ = ±3 over 7; tan Θ = ±square root 33 sin Θ = ±33 over 7; tan Θ = ±square root 33 over 7 sin Θ = ±square root 33 over 7; tan Θ = ±square root 33 over 7

we have that\
cos Θ=-4/7

we know that
cos² Θ+sin² Θ=1----------> sin² Θ=1-cos² Θ
sin² Θ=1-(-4/7)²------> 1-16/49-----> 33/49
sin² Θ=33/49---------> sin Θ=±(√33)/7

tan Θ=sin Θ/cos Θ-------> [±(√33)/7]/[-4/7]----> ±(√33)/4

the answer is
sin Θ = ±square root 33 over 7; tan Θ = ±square root 33 over 4
